María Victoria Soulé is a Spanish Language Instructor and Researcher at the Language Centre of the Cyprus University of Technology. She completed her BA in Classical Studies at the University of Barcelona, an MA in teaching Spanish as a Foreign Language from Universidad Complutense de Madrid, an MPhil in Spanish Applied Linguistics and a PhD in Applied Linguistics (Suma Cum Laude) from Universidad Nacional de Educación a Distancia (UNED), Spain. She was awarded for excellence in research with the UNED University Extraordinary Doctoral Prize (Premio Extraordinario de Doctorado) in 2016.

Her current research interests include (a) Classroom-based research: (a) The use of Technology Enhanced-Learning (TEL) and Computer Assisted Language Learning (CALL), (b) Plurilingualism, and (C) Study abroad. She has published scientific articles in internationally acclaimed journals and has participated in research programs and academic conferences. In the last years she has been participating as a researcher in EU funded research projects: DC4LTDE-TEL, HEROVALIANT, COST actions SAREP and LITHME, and international funded projects: PAPIME (Universidad Nacional Autónoma de México) and Language Teaching Research Jeon-ra-buk-do (South Korea Department of Education, Science and Technology).
